Ducon Infratechnologies Limited recently participated in the GH2 Summit in Delhi, where they showcased their advanced fluid control systems designed for hydrogen mobility, storage, and safety. This event, supported by the Ministry of Heavy Industries and organized by the Sustainable Development Leaders Council, highlighted Ducon's commitment to driving India's hydrogen transformation. Prime Minister Narendra Modi's emphasis on producing 5 million metric tons of green hydrogen annually by 2030 further underlines India's leadership in green hydrogen, with significant tenders already issued. The summit also addressed challenges in developing hydrogen infrastructure, especially in transportation and shipping sectors due to the corrosiveness of pure hydrogen. Ducon's specialized components like solenoid valves and pressure regulators are tailored for high-pressure and corrosive conditions, making them essential for safe hydrogen transport. With their ability to provide solutions for both hydrogen and ammonia applications, Ducon is well-positioned to support government initiatives like hydrogen transport corridors and pilot projects for hydrogen-powered vehicles, ships, and rockets. Ducon Infratechnologies Limited is a prominent player in clean coal technology, with a focus on bringing clean technologies to various sectors like utilities, chemicals, steel, and cement. Their expertise in FGD systems and bulk material handling, along with continuous investments in clean energy IP, showcase their commitment to sustainable development and energy transition in India.
